Sec. 10-28b. School volunteers; information and assistance about; state-wide coordinator; state plan.

The Department of Education shall
(1)provide information and technical assistance to local and regional boards of education regarding the involvement of volunteers and other partners, including parents and representatives from business and the community, in public school programs and activities,
(2)designate an employee of the department as state-wide school volunteer coordinator, and
(3)not later than January 15, 1991, in consultation with the Connecticut Association of Partners in Education, Inc., develop a state plan to encourage, enhance and support the involvement of school volunteers and other partners in education and submit such plan to the joint standing committee of the General Assembly having cognizance of matters relating to education. The provisions of this section shall be carried out within the limits of available appropriations.
